Accordion-heavy pop hits, wooden beer hall tables and vaulted ceilings, come together to form this den of schnitzel. The menu consists mainly of... well - schnitzel and they will certainly have you yodelling. Just in case you're not in the mood for a pounded-flat, breaded and fried meal, they've also got a few other meaty mains to choose from and a 'Radler' on the drink menu was also a plus.

    Not great. The schnitzel was good and respectably large, but the sides were bland. The restaurant's website doesn't include a drinks list, so it was an unpleasant surprise to see the German brews cost nearly 5€, which is some of the most expensive beer you can get in Tallinn - even compared to Town Hall Square. (Local beers were a bit less but still too much for this kind of joint). The applestrudel was at least 2 days old and nuked to molten lava temperatures in a microwave. So all in all, the experience was disappointing. If the prices were 30-40% cheaper, then it might be an "ok" choice, but there are numerous pubs nearby that can provide good food with cheaper drinks and at better atmosphere.
